Skip to Main Content
Return to Navigation

Running Mass Compile

The Mass Compile metadata utility enables you to either compile individual metadata objects, or all metadata objects.

As discussed in the "Setting Up and Working with Metadata" topic of this documentation, if you change a table, you must recompile record metadata for that table. For instance, if you add a non-key column to a table, you must recompile the record metadata. If you add a key column, you must recompile both the record metadata and any tablemaps, datamaps, constraints, or other metadata objects associated with it. The advantage of Mass Compile is that you can opt to compile all metadata objects at once. In addition, if you have imported metadata into the database and validated it, you can compile it using Mass Compile.

Note: Mass Compile will not compile allocation manager rules that are period-based or have the multiple business unit option selected. These rules will be skipped and must be compiled from the Allocation Manager Rules component.

This topic discusses how to compile metadata objects using Mass Compile.

Page Used to Run Mass Compile

Page Name

Definition Name

Navigation

Usage

Compile Metadata Changes

RUN_PF_COMPILE

select EPM Foundation, then select Foundation Metadata, then select Other Metadata Operations, then select Compile Metadata Changes

Compile metadata objects by running Mass Compile. To view errors, see select the Process Monitor or Report Manager link.

Compile Metadata Changes Page

Use the Compile Metadata Changes page (RUN_PF_COMPILE) to compile metadata objects by running Mass Compile. To view errors, see select the Process Monitor or Report Manager link.

Image: Compile Metadata Changes page

This example illustrates the fields and controls on the Compile Metadata Changes page. You can find definitions for the fields and controls later on this page.

Compile Metadata Changes page

You can either select all objects, or individually select the objects you want to validate in the Metadata Type, Performance Management Warehouse, Activity-Based Management, Scorecard, and Workforce Analytics group boxes.